Title: Innovator Profile: Sang-Doo Kim
Introduction: Sang-Doo Kim is a distinguished inventor based in Yangsan, South Korea. He has made significant contributions to the field of immunology, particularly through his innovative patent aimed at addressing immune-related disorders.
Latest Patents: Sang-Doo Kim holds a patent for a "Composition and method for preventing and treating immune-related disorder." This invention pertains to an immunoregulating agent that includes a peptide and a pharmaceutical composition. It focuses on preventing or treating severe sepsis or acute respiratory distress syndrome (ARDS). Furthermore, it showcases the use of peptides as anti-inflammatory agents, antibacterial agents, and inhibitors of immune cell apoptosis.
Career Highlights: Throughout his career, Sang-Doo has been affiliated with prominent research foundations. Notably, he has worked at the POSTECH (Pohang University of Science and Technology) Academy-Industry Foundation and the Dong-a University Research Foundation for Industry-Academy Cooperation.
